Always feel free to ask. I have more DCS in the pipeline, but this time smaller base kits with more child kits. 9009 was kitted with 'big base' because, well, its beige, and a one size fits all (well most) was the best approach. However for almost every other instance, smaller kits are easier to wok with, and SPs pricing is significantly better off with smaller kits and higher MOQ.

I dont think i addressed this but, at the same MOQ, the cost alone would be close to $160, including vendor markups, and not including shipping, for the same base kit. PBT works with smaller bases and child kits. I wish i could but given DCS is not hugely popular already, ABS for this set at least was teh way to go. Plus, ABS DCS sounds insane.
